    The Independent Power Generators, Ghana (IPGG) has extended its warmest congratulations to President-elect John Dramani Mahama on his re-election. This milestone achievement is a testament to the confidence the Ghanaian people have in his leadership.

    According to IPGG, President-elect Mahama’s victory is not just a personal achievement, but also a source of hope for the entire nation. His leadership is expected to bring about positive change and development in various sectors of the economy, including the energy sector.

    The energy sector in Ghana has faced numerous challenges in recent years, including financial sustainability, liquidity crises, and gaps in leadership and policy direction. However, with President-elect Mahama’s re-election, IPGG sees a renewed opportunity to address these challenges and create a resilient and efficient energy sector.

    IPGG believes that President-elect Mahama’s leadership will bring about the restoration of stability, transparency, and innovation in the energy sector. This, in turn, will create a favorable environment for investment, growth, and development in the sector.
